CBD Infused Tea

CBD-infused tea is a popular and enjoyable way for individuals to incorporate cannabidiol (CBD) into their daily routines. CBD tea blends typically combine the potential benefits of CBD with the soothing and aromatic qualities of various tea varieties. Here's what you need to know about CBD-infused tea:

  1. Varieties of Tea:
    • CBD-infused teas come in various types, such as black tea, green tea, herbal tea, and more. The choice of tea variety can influence the overall flavor and potential additional benefits, as different herbs and botanicals may be included.
  2. CBD Content:
    • The CBD content in each tea bag or serving can vary. It's important to check the product's label for information on the CBD concentration per serving. Dosages can range, so individuals can choose products with CBD levels that suit their preferences and needs.
  3. Full Spectrum vs. Isolate:
    • CBD-infused teas may contain either full-spectrum CBD or CBD isolate. Full-spectrum CBD includes a range of cannabinoids and terpenes from the hemp plant, potentially providing an "entourage effect." CBD isolate, on the other hand, contains pure CBD without other cannabinoids.
  4. Flavor Profiles:
    • CBD teas often come in a variety of flavor profiles, including classic blends, fruity infusions, and herbal combinations. Some products may also include additional herbs like chamomile or lavender to enhance relaxation.
  5. Brewing Process:
    • Brewing CBD tea is similar to brewing regular tea. Typically, you steep the tea bag in hot water for a few minutes. However, it's essential to follow the specific brewing instructions provided by the manufacturer to ensure proper infusion.
  6. Lab Testing and Quality:
    • Choose CBD teas from reputable brands that conduct third-party lab testing. This ensures that the product contains the stated amount of CBD, is free from contaminants, and meets quality standards.
  7. Benefits and Effects:
    • CBD is believed to have potential calming and anti-anxiety effects. When combined with the calming ritual of tea consumption, individuals may experience relaxation and a sense of well-being. However, individual responses can vary.
  8. Legal Considerations:
    • Ensure that the CBD-infused tea complies with local regulations. CBD laws can vary, so it's essential to purchase products from reputable sources that adhere to legal standards.


CBD-infused tea provides a convenient and enjoyable way for individuals to integrate CBD into their wellness routines. As with any CBD product, it's advisable to start with a lower dosage and monitor individual responses. If you have specific health concerns or are taking medications, consult with a healthcare professional before incorporating CBD into your routine.
